If you leave for a hike at 2:00 pm and expect to travel approximately 2 miles per hour for a 5-1/4 mile journey, what time would you expect to arrive?

To determine the expected arrival time for a hike of 5-1/4 miles at a speed of 2 miles per hour, first, you need to calculate the time it will take to complete the journey.

The total distance of 5-1/4 miles can be converted to a decimal, which is 5.25 miles. To find the time taken for the hike, divide the total distance by the speed:

5.25 miles ÷ 2 miles per hour = 2.625 hours.

To make this easier to understand in terms of hours and minutes, note that 0.625 hours equates to 37.5 minutes (0.625 × 60 minutes). So, the total time for the hike is 2 hours and 37.5 minutes.

Starting at 2:00 pm, adding 2 hours brings you to 4:00 pm. Adding the additional 37.5 minutes results in a final expected arrival time of approximately 4:37 pm.
